If you like dealing with people, help us sell First Night buttons! You'll also be selling tickets for our big events at the Flynn Center and Memorial Auditorium. If you like, bring a couple friends and do it together! You can work in our downtown office at 230 College Street, at the Burlington Town Center, or one of our other downtown locations....or you can help us deliver buttons throughout the Burlington area to local banks, supermarkets and stores. We need volunteers on weekdays starting in November and, after Thanksgiving, on weekends as well! We especially need button and ticket sellers the day of the event, December 31st. If you agree to at least 3 hours of volunteer time, you'll get a FREE FIRST NIGHT BUTTON!
Retail experience is a plus since volunteers will be working with button and ticket sales. Attention to detail is important. For those of you helping us with online sales, feeling comfortable working with computers is required.  This opportunity is sponsored by: First Night Burlington, Inc.
